If you want the patches to be a closer match sometimes we add small amounts of grout to our patch. Specifically unsanded grout to get it closer to the color of the original slab. Not a big deal but we’ve had customers complain and make a really big stink in the past. Now we do it on every job just to avoid negative feedback.
